Senior Software Developer – Full Remote

Posted Jul 25

This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in Germany.

📋 Description

• Responsible for the design, development, and maintenance of our web applications and native administrative applications utilizing C#, .NET, Blazor, JavaScript, and SQL Server.

• Involved in the technical design and ongoing enhancement of both existing and new components for the frontend and backend.

• Responsible for designing and implementing REST interfaces while integrating external systems and services.

• Collaborate closely with architecture, product owners, and business units to fulfill functional and technical requirements.

• Undertake selected DevOps responsibilities related to build, release, and deployment management, as well as the enhancement of our CI/CD pipelines.

• Manage and technically execute regulatory and domain-specific requirements within the healthcare sector, particularly regarding certification processes from KBV, Gematik, and other relevant organizations.

• Ensure code quality and adherence to software standards through code reviews, automated testing, and mentoring junior developers.

• Utilize modern tools such as Azure DevOps, Git, and automated build and deployment processes.

• Engage in the continuous enhancement of development processes, tools, and technical standards.

• Work closely with product owners, business units, and other stakeholders to effectively meet customer and market demands.


⛳️ Requirements

• Bachelor's degree in Computer Science or a related field.

• Multiple years of professional experience in full-stack development utilizing modern .NET technologies.

• Strong expertise in C#, JavaScript, Blazor, and relational databases (SQL Server).

• Proficient in the development and integration of REST APIs.

• Familiarity with modern development tools and methodologies, particularly Git, Azure DevOps, and CI/CD processes.

• A keen interest in further advancing CI/CD, build, and deployment processes.

• Experience with regulatory requirements, ideally including certification procedures in the healthcare domain.

• Preferred: knowledge of contemporary authentication and authorization technologies (e.g., OAuth2, OpenID Connect, Duende IdentityServer, Keycloak, or similar solutions).

• Ideally, experience within the healthcare sector, specifically with KBV, Gematik, TI, or other eHealth solutions.

• Strong team collaboration and communication skills, along with a high degree of self-initiative and a structured, solution-oriented approach to work.

• Proficient in German and possess good English language skills.
